Title: 八零后重生日常

Chapters: 148 + 3 Extras

Tags: rebirth, childhood sweetheart, poor to rich, writer MC

Synopsis:

Returning to his childhood, re-experiencing the turbulent 1980s and 990s. Their mother died young and his father remarried, what to do if the adults are unreliable? Then, you should be self-reliant! But what can he do at a young age?

Getting rich started from earning manuscript fees and ended up accidentally on the richest writer's list.

He helped a big, fierce man and the other party stuck to him and couldn't get rid of it again.

Then let's just get rich together.

He originally wanted to train a newcomer, why did they guy become the coal boss in the end?

Li Lei: Xiao Yu, you are clearly the President!

So our MC was reborn when he was a kid. I don't think his pre-rebirth self was ever clearly mentioned. It was mentioned though that they had a hard time because of their stepmother. For example, her sister's marriage was miserable cos their stepmother married her to a bad man. Anywayyys, MC was reborn as a kid when the stepmother was just newly married. His dad is a technical worker in a coal mine owned by the state, so their standard of living is okay (not too poor or too rich)

In order to earn money, MC wrote children stories and submitted them to magazines with the help of ML. ML is an orphaned kid living in the same unit, he has a violent reputation but he is good to MC. He decided to treat MC as his 'younger brother', always worried that he would be bullied cos he is so much younger than their classmates (MC skipped grades and became ML's classmates). Because MC knows that ML's aunt/uncle never gives him money, he gives ML several money-making ideas so ML can save up money for his own tuition in the future.

After getting his stories publish, MC got a LOT of manuscript fees. He decided to buy his own shop and let his Aunt manage it. They set up a rental bookstore and then a video rental store. Laters, he got more money from the manuscript and the store's profits and bought stocks. He waited until it got to the highest price and then sold it all with the price increasing several times. They opened a video arcade store and lent money for ML to buy a house in the county so he can moved out of his Uncle's place and become neighbors again with MC. 

Timeskip and MC is studying now on a highschool in the provincial capital, ML worked extra hard on his studies so he can get admitted on a technical school  in the provincial capital as well. Anyways, he takes care of MC's life during the weekends (since he lives in the dormitory) cooking for him and stuff. Laters, he discovers his mind that he likes MC and was immediately worried that he is weird cos he never knew that boys can like boys. ML is sooo pure and its so distressing cos he is so humble to MC saying that he will always remain brothers with MC and that when MC gets married and have kids, he will take care of MC's kids as well.

Then MC gets admitted to a University in the Capital and ML follows again. He didn't go to college but became a taxi driver instead. He lives with MC and takes care of his life. After testing/bullying ML again and again, MC eventually agrees to be with him. Actually, ML's initial goal was to become a coal mine boss cos he remembered MC say that it would be profitable when they were kids. When he heard that some coal mines can be contracted, he tells MC and MC invests and let him be the coal mine Boss. I like the childhood arc which is pretty long (2/3 of the novel) and most of it is about MC's writing career and business investments. ML really treats MC as a younger brother, coaxing him, going along with his money-making plans (the stocks) just so the little guy won't sulk if no one supports him. Not much about MC's family. Author-sama made the stepmother go away (she went away to do business and only came back near the ending), MC's dad isn't involve in MC's businesses (MC Dad is actually quite good though) and even the sister which MC vowed to protect is reduced to the background. Truthfully, MC's aunt's family has more exposure cos MC would often look for them for business matters.

Romance is not much either. After ML discovers his thoughts, he told MC about it right away and promised him that its okay for them to stay as 'brothers'. Like I said, its very distressing how he is so humble to MC. In fact, their relationship is really unbalanced since ML is always the one working  hard to maintain it. When MC's family moved out of the coal miner's unit and moved to the county, MC thought they would eventually lose contact. But then, ML borrowed money from him just so they could be neighbors; same when MC moved the provincial capital, ML worked hard to improve his grades to catch up and when MC moved to the Capital, ML straight out dropped his studies to follow him. And it just feels bad for me cos ML is really innocent and confused about his sexuality/feelings for MC, whereas MC already has a mature mind/completely aware of it and he has this mentality of watching the fun/tossing ML (Its not malicious, but I feel bad for ML). 

So yeah, my favorite part is the llooongg childhood arc, its a fun arc, just two kiddos getting rich through their own ideas~ MC makes big business and ML does small ones. Started to dislike MC a bit when the romance happened cos he keeps tossing our confused teen ML. It doesn't feel sad/dramatic though since ML has an optimistic personality. 

Read this for MC-focused rebirth, not much about family or revenge etc.
